About this facility
Guardian Care Nursing & Rehabilitation Center is a non-profit corporation-owned skilled nursing facility in Orlando, Orange County, Florida. It has been Medicare and Medicaid certified since July 1993 and is licensed for 120 certified beds, with an average of 91 residents.
According to CMS Care Compare, Guardian Care holds an overall star rating of 2 out of 5, which is below the Florida state average of 3.27. Its component ratings are: health inspection rating of 2 stars, staffing rating of 3 stars, and quality measure (QM) rating of 4 stars.
Nurse staffing data show total nurse hours per resident per day of approximately 3.39, with registered nurse (RN) hours per resident per day of about 0.58. Nursing staff turnover is reported at 78.6%.
On the penalty record, CMS reports 0 federal fines totaling $0.00 — no federal fines on record — and no payment denials. No abuse icon is displayed for this facility, and it is not listed under CMS's Special Focus Facility program, which is reserved for facilities CMS identifies as persistently underperforming and subject to increased inspection.
No chain affiliation is indicated in the available data, and there has been no change of ownership in the past 12 months.
